About the area

San Diego

This holiday home is located in Bankers Hill, a neighbourhood in San Diego. B Street Cruise Ship Terminal and Port of San Diego are worth checking out if an activity is on the agenda, while those wishing to experience the area's natural beauty can explore Balboa Park and Waterfront Park. Check out an event or a game at Petco Park, and consider making time for San Diego Zoo, a top attraction not to be missed.

Interesting stay, convenient location
The location of the property is central and without traffic only 15 minutes from Mission Beach (which is why we were visiting).The listing indicates that this is in the direct flight path of the San Diego airport. Sure is! All you have to do is look up and you’ll see the bottom of a plane flying right over...so close you feel like you could reach up and touch them. (They stopped flying somewhere around 11:00 pm.) Parking is a nightmare if you’re not good at parallel parking, and spaces are extremely limited. The cottage is quaint and welcoming. Dogs are allowed and that worked out great. There is a courtyard for them to potty and it’s gated so they can’t run off. We arrived around noon (requested 12:30 check in)and after driving around for 20 minutes waiting for someone to leave so that we could park, I finally just double parked to go and see if the place was ready for us. I had been in contact with the owner via text to confirm 12:30 check in and conveyed that this was our intention. Upon arrival there was a very nice guy cleaning named Tony. He advised he was not ready for us yet as he was not aware we had requested early check in. He said he’d be about 30 minutes. Fortunately in the time it took to find this out a space opened up that I didn’t have to parallel park in (it was on the corner so I could just pull in, I’m terrible at parallel parking!). We waited around until 1:30 before we could unload the car. We were not charged the customary early check in fee of $50 which was gracious, and despite a few things that need to be addressed this is actually a good place to stay. Things that need immediate attention: The shower curtain needs replaced in the tub. It’s ripped at the top and is basically pointless. The queen mattress needs to go to the dumpster. (Literally folding in half.) It was humid during our stay and with no ac quite uncomfortable (we’re from Arizona where we don’t deal with humidity). We ended up going to Lowe’s and buying a fan. Although that helped we still had to keep the widows open. Unfortunately this allowed the neighbors marijuana aroma to waft into our cottage. We don’t smoke it so this was quite annoying, and I’m positive that they were up all night as I did not sleep through the night and could hear them having a good time. This is the first time that we have stayed inland when coming to San Diego and location is key. That being said, with the issues I couldn’t imagine staying here more than a day or two at max.
